Sidewalk Film Fest organizers pursuing arthouse theater concept

by

As Sidewalk Film Festival prepares to get its 18th festival underway at the end of August, organizers will have one extra project on their minds.

Chloe Cook, Sidewalk's executive director, said the organization is currently considering the possibility of creating an arthouse theater in downtown Birmingham. A feasibility study is currently underway to determine community support for such a project.

The study is scheduled to be completed and reviewed in mid-August, after which more details will become available. One potential location being considered is the lower level of The Pizitz building, located at 1821 2nd Ave. N., below the Pizitz Food Hall.

Cook said Sidewalk is envisioning a two-screen theater to be a permanent home for first-run indie films and repertoire films. There would also likely be a full bar.
